About this sunscreen
Lea SUN Kids Sun Care Milk is an SPF 50 chemical sunscreen using older- generation Ethylhexyl Methoxycinnamate with some Titanium Dioxide. It wears with a balanced finish, feels lightweight and shows low white cast, and it does not commonly sting, which suits a kids format. Pore-clogging potential is low and makeup compatibility is okay. Protection is rated weak and the score of 49.0 is the lowest here, reflecting a thin, dated filter list.

Is Lea SUN Kids sunscreen gentle for kids' skin?
It does not commonly sting, which suits a kids format, and pore-clogging potential is low. As always, patch testing is generally wise for young skin.
Is the Lea SUN Kids Sun Care Milk SPF 50 mineral or chemical?
It is mainly chemical, using older-generation Ethylhexyl Methoxycinnamate with some Titanium Dioxide.
Is Lea SUN Kids SPF 50 a strong sunscreen?
Its protection is rated weak and it scores 49.0 out of 100, the lowest in its set. The thin, dated filter list is the main reason.
